Error Codes

CodeMeaningFix
L3Delay Appliance Load (DAL) mode active - SMART GRID signal receivedRefrigerator is in demand response mode. If unwanted, press Peak Demand Off button or wait for signal duration to end (max. 4.5 hours)
L4Temporary Appliance Load Reduction (TALR) mode active - SMART GRID signal receivedRefrigerator is in aggressive load reduction mode. Mode will deactivate in max. 15 minutes or when door opens/dispenser used, or press Peak Demand Off button
OrPeak Demand Off (Override mode) is activeRefrigerator is ignoring SMART GRID signals. Press Fridge button for 3 seconds to deactivate if no longer needed
Filter Reset Indicator Blinking RedWater filter needs replacement (after approximately 6 months or 300 gallons)Replace water filter cartridge with Samsung-approved filter and press Ice Maker button for 3 seconds to reset indicator

Troubleshooting

Refrigerator does not cool properly

Cause: Vents are blocked, door left open, or thermostat set incorrectly
Solution: Check that air vents are not blocked by food or plastic bags, close door completely, verify temperature settings are correct

Water dispenser not working

Cause: Water filter clogged, water line not connected, or water supply line shut off
Solution: Replace water filter, check water line connections are tight, verify main water supply is on

Ice maker not producing ice

Cause: Water line disconnected, water filter clogged, or ice maker turned off
Solution: Press Test button on ice maker to verify operation, check water line connection, replace water filter if needed, verify ice maker is turned on

Door will not close properly

Cause: Refrigerator not leveled or door hinges misaligned
Solution: Use leveling feet to properly level refrigerator, check door alignment and adjust using snap rings if needed

Abnormal sounds from refrigerator

Cause: Normal operational sounds or ice making in progress
Solution: Allow 1-2 days for ice maker to normalize, listen for specific sound type in troubleshooting section

Temperature display blinking

Cause: Door left open frequently or large amount of food added, causing temperature to rise above set point
Solution: Close door completely, reduce amount of food added at once, allow time for temperature to stabilize

Water from dispenser has abnormal smell or taste

Cause: Water dispenser not used for 2-3 days
Solution: Discard first 1-2 glasses of water before using

Water appears cloudy when dispensed

Cause: Water pressure increase during filtering causes oxygen and nitrogen saturation
Solution: This is normal; water will clear after a few seconds

AutoFill Pitcher not filling or overflowing

Cause: Water line not properly connected or pitcher not seated correctly in holder
Solution: Check water line connection, remove and reseat pitcher in holder, check for moisture on pitcher contact points

Ice bucket tray not staying in place or ice dropping behind bucket

Cause: Ice bucket not fully inserted
Solution: Ensure ice bucket tray is fully inserted until it clicks into place

Ice chunks forming in bucket

Cause: Ice stored for long time undergoes sublimation, or clumping after power loss
Solution: Empty ice bucket and remove clumped ice, turn off ice maker if extended storage expected, discard first buckets after power failure

Door bins falling or not staying in place

Cause: Bin not inserted fully or filled with too much weight
Solution: Empty bin, insert slightly above final position ensuring back is against door, press down firmly

Frost buildup in drawers or on walls

Cause: Drawers not closing properly or filled too much
Solution: Do not overload freezer/FlexZone drawers, ensure drawers close completely, check proper basket positioning

Reset Procedures

Filter Reset

  1. When Filter Reset indicator blinks red, water filter needs replacement
  2. Shut off water supply line
  3. Open filter cartridge cover
  4. Turn filter knob counter clockwise 90 degrees (1/4 turn) to unlock
  5. Pull cartridge straight out to remove
  6. Insert new Samsung-approved filter cartridge
  7. Turn cartridge knob clockwise to lock into place
  8. Close filter cartridge cover
  9. Press and hold Ice Maker button for 3 seconds to reset filter lifecycle
  10. Open water valve and run water through dispenser for approximately 7 minutes to remove impurities and air

Display Reset (Family Hub and AI Home Hub models)

  1. Open the fridge door
  2. Locate switch cover on top right corner of door
  3. Push up the cover to reveal power switch
  4. Turn power off
  5. Turn power on
  6. Reinsert switch cover to the end until clicking sound is heard

MAC Address Display (General type models)

  1. Press and hold both Freezer and Fridge buttons for 6 seconds
  2. Temperature panel will blink
  3. Press Freezer button again to display MAC address
  4. MAC address displays sequentially for 1 minute in format: -- / -- then 11 / 22 then 33 / 44 then 55 / 66 then -- / --
  5. After 1 minute, MAC address disappears and panel returns to normal state
